CHIJMES is a historic landmark in the heart of Singapore, best known for its stunning Gothic architecture and vibrant dining scene.

The site began as a convent and girls’ school (the Convent of the Holy Infant Jesus), but now it’s a buzzing social hub with restaurants, bars, and event spaces.

The highlight is the CHIJMES Hall—a former chapel now used for weddings, concerts, and private functions, featuring tall stained-glass windows and high vaulted ceilings.

Dining options at CHIJMES are diverse: you’ll find everything from Japanese izakayas and Spanish tapas bars to Italian trattorias, wine bars, steakhouses, and modern Asian bistros.

There’s also a lively nightlife scene, with alfresco bars and regular live music or sports screenings click here on big screens in the courtyard.

Families also enjoy exploring the peaceful gardens and historic corridors during the day.
